Key Ingredients & Substitutions

Ground Beef: I recommend an 80/20 blend for juiciness. However, you can use leaner beef or even ground turkey if you’re looking for a lighter option. Just remember, the less fat, the less juicy your taco may be.

Cheese: American cheese is traditional here because it melts perfectly. If you prefer a different cheese, try cheddar or pepper jack for a little heat!

Tortillas: Use flour or corn tortillas based on your preference. If you want a low-carb option, you could also use lettuce wraps instead.

Special Sauce: If you don’t have all the ingredients for the Big Mac sauce, some folks use store-bought Thousand Island dressing or just mayo mixed with ketchup. Either is a quick solution!

How Do I Get the Perfect Smash Burger Patties?

The key to great smash burgers is high heat and quick cooking. First, make sure your skillet is really hot before adding your meat. This helps form a nice crust.

  • Form loose balls of meat and smash them down immediately — don’t be shy!
  • Don’t flip too soon; let them cook until the edges are crispy for that juicy scoop.
  • After flipping, add cheese quickly so it melts while the patty finishes cooking.

Ingredients You’ll Need:

Main Ingredients:

  • 1 lb ground beef (80/20 blend for best juiciness)
  • Salt and pepper, to taste
  • 8 small flour or corn tortillas (6-inch)
  • 4 slices American cheese
  • 1 cup shredded iceberg lettuce
  • 1/4 cup finely chopped white onion
  • 8 dill pickle slices
  • 1/2 cup Thousand Island dressing or special sauce (see below)

Special Sauce (Big Mac style):

  • 1/2 cup mayonnaise
  • 2 tbsp ketchup
  • 1 tbsp sweet pickle relish
  • 1 tsp white vinegar
  • 1 tsp sugar
  • 1/2 tsp garlic powder
  • 1/2 tsp onion powder
  • Pinch of salt

Step-by-Step Instructions:

1. Make the Special Sauce:

In a small bowl, whisk together the mayonnaise, ketchup, sweet pickle relish, white vinegar, sugar, garlic powder, onion powder, and salt. Mix until smooth. Pop it in the fridge while you prepare the rest of the tacos to let the flavors meld together.

2. Cook the Smash Burgers:

Heat a large cast-iron skillet or griddle over medium-high heat until very hot—this is key for that crispy edge! Divide your ground beef into 8 equal portions (about 2 ounces each) and roll them loosely into balls. Place each ball onto the hot skillet and immediately smash it down with a spatula to form thin patties (don’t be shy!). Season each patty with salt and pepper. Cook without moving them for about 2 minutes until the edges are brown and crispy. Flip the patties, place a slice of cheese on each one, and cook for another minute until the cheese melts and the patties are cooked through. Once done, remove them from the skillet and keep warm.

3. Warm the Tortillas:

While your burgers are cooking, warm the tortillas. You can do this in a dry skillet or by carefully warming them directly over a gas flame for just a few seconds on each side until they’re warm and pliable. Just be careful not to burn them!

4. Assemble the Tacos:

Take each tortilla and spread about 1 tablespoon of the special sauce onto it. Place one cheesy smash burger patty onto each tortilla. Top them off with shredded lettuce, chopped onions, and 1-2 dill pickle slices. If you like extra sauce, drizzle on some more for added goodness!

FAQ for Easy Smash Burger Tacos Inspired by Big Mac

Can I Use Leaner Beef for This Recipe?

Yes, you can use leaner beef if you prefer, but keep in mind that an 80/20 blend provides the best juiciness and flavor. If you choose to go leaner, consider adding a little olive oil to keep the patties moist while cooking.

How Can I Store Leftover Tacos?

If you have leftovers, store the components separately in airtight containers. The taco filling can be kept in the fridge for up to 3 days, while the tortillas should be stored in a plastic bag to prevent them from drying out. When ready to enjoy, reheat the filling in a skillet and warm the tortillas before assembling again.

What Tortilla Options Can I Use?

You can use either flour or corn tortillas based on your preference. If you want a healthier option, feel free to use lettuce wraps instead of tortillas for a low-carb alternative!

Can I Make This Recipe Without the Special Sauce?

Absolutely! If you’re short on time or ingredients, you can simply use store-bought Thousand Island dressing or even ketchup and mayo as a quick substitute. However, the special sauce adds a unique flavor that really enhances the dish!
